#90bae0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#90bae0 is composed of 56.5% red, 72.9%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.7% cyan, 17%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 72.2%. #90bae0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2175c1.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#90bae0 color description : Very soft blue.

#90bae0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#90bae0 has RGB values of R:144, G:186,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 9485024.

Shades and Tints of #90bae0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080c is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#90bae0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b8ba is the less saturated color, while #75bbfb is the most saturated one.
